Summary Position: Digital Reporter, Bell Media, CTV News Vancouver
Job Status: Regular -Full TimeLocation: Vancouver, B.C. (can work remotely but must be available to come into the office when needed) Hours of work: 40 hours per week Role CTV News Vancouver is seeking an experienced Digital Reporter to join our dynamic team in the heart of downtown Vancouver in a full-time position. The successful application will bolster our weekend coverage, working Friday through Tuesday, and must be able to hit the ground running in a fast-paced, deadline-driven newsroom that covers breaking news. Key Responsibilities
Write and package stories for the CTV News Vancouver website
Pitch original story ideas, cover breaking news as it happens and occasionally adapt TV stories into digital articles
Provide peer copyediting for fellow reporters
Send time-sensitive breaking news emails and app push alerts
Publish digital video content prepared by our editing team to our website
Critical Qualifications
Journalism degree or diploma
Relevant digital reporting and copyediting experience, with a focus on accuracy and a strong grasp of CP Style
Ability to juggle multiple tasks in a high-pressure environment
Exceptional team player
Preferred Qualifications
Demonstrated knowledge of B.C. news and current affairs
Experience working with content management systems
Keen ability to think visually and apply graphic design elements to storytelling
Proficiency with social media apps and understanding of social trends
Awareness of emerging mobile news standards
Enthusiasm for new technology and storytelling techniques
